Digital health promises smarter care, but can ecosystems integrate it into real practice? Discover how Europe balances technology with human trust, workflow integration, and everyday implementation.
Digital tools are reshaping care delivery, from personalized services to smarter prevention and monitoring. The real challenge: integrating them into workflows,into minds, and into budgets.
In this episode of the THCS Podcast, Donna Henderson (NHS Scotland) brings a European perspective on digital health adoption. Etty Ragnhild Nilsen (Norway’s CoTecH) showcases a national partnership shaping digital services. And Elisabeth Haslinger-Baumann presents LinkedCare in Austria, an ecosystem experimenting with interoperability and trust in digital care.
Together, their insights reveal how digitization can move from buzzwords to reality when embedded into real ecosystems.
